Output 780fa7010abab53bfcc859698fa350861378065a6aba738e43671158d7e0ba76:5

value
28729211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fbabad402fb87f6eeec90040c5a9c139b54a19 OP_EQUAL
address
M8Aw5CEizbcJcjNffBtmg2PYe7duezRGxK
transaction
780fa7010abab53bfcc859698fa350861378065a6aba738e43671158d7e0ba76
spent
true